This serif typeface shows pronounced thick–thin modulation with hairline joins and finely cut, tapered serifs. Curves are smooth and controlled, with a vertical stress and a generally open, luminous texture in text. Capitals are stately and narrow-to-moderate in proportion, while lowercase forms keep a balanced, readable structure with delicate terminals and small, precise details (notably in the ball terminals and thin cross strokes). Numerals follow the same high-contrast logic, with slim horizontals and elegant, restrained curves.

It is well suited to editorial typography—magazines, book interiors with generous margins, and cultured branding—where high contrast can add hierarchy and sophistication. It can also perform nicely for display uses like headings, pull quotes, and event materials, especially when printed or rendered at sizes that retain the fine details.

The overall tone is polished and cultured, leaning toward editorial sophistication rather than utilitarian ruggedness. Its delicate contrast and crisp finishing convey a sense of luxury and ceremony, suitable for settings where typographic finesse is part of the message.

The design appears intended to deliver classic, high-fashion serif refinement with a clean, contemporary discipline. It emphasizes elegance through verticality, sharp finishing, and controlled contrast to create an upscale reading and display voice.

The design relies on very thin connecting strokes, so it reads best when given enough size and reproduction quality to preserve the hairlines. Spacing appears measured and even, contributing to a calm, upscale rhythm in paragraph samples.
